Library of Congress Liability for Increased 1973 Postage Charges

B-114874 Sep 16, 1975

Highlights

An opinion was requested on questions related to payment to the U.S. Postal Service (USPS) of increased postage charges assessed for fiscal year (FY) 1973. The failure of Congress to fully satisfy the amount due USPS for additional FY 1973 postal charges did not extinguish such liability as a matter of law. Thus the Library should restore and apply expired 1973 appropriation balances to the USPS debt. However, to the extent that the debt cannot be fully paid thereby, it must remain unsatisfied since no source other than the 1973 appropriation balances is available for that purpose.
